Membership Options

One of the key advantages of Shopify is its free trial period, enabling you to explore the possibilities of its features, establish your online store, and gain insights into how the platform operates without incurring any any financial risk or commitment. No credit card details are necessary during this trial period, allowing for authentically risk-free experimentation and uninhibited exploration of the platform’s capabilities.Shopify Basic is the entry-level plan, but don’t be misled by its name: this plan comes packed with essential features for new businesses or those just getting into online sales.

Shopify Basic gives you access to all of the core features of their platform, including selling and promoting an limitless products, 2 staff accounts for managing your business, sales channels for both online and social media selling channels, around-the-clock customer support in addition to an SSL certificate and fraud analysis tools for added protection of your business.

Shopify Basic may not provide access to all of the premium features found in higher-tier plans, but it offers an outstanding starting point for launching an e-commerce venture.

Shopify Plan is the mid-tier plan designed for growing businesses that need additional features beyond what the Basic Plan can provide. It includes everything included in Basic, as well as professional reports to analyze business performance; international domains and languages to extend your audience worldwide; and reduced transaction fees which help increase profitability and drive your profits.

Shopify Advanced is designed for high-volume sellers and businesses seeking to scale. It contains all of the features of the Shopify Plan as well as added tools like a sophisticated reporting tool for more in-depth business analysis, third-party calculated shipping rates for more accurate cost estimation, and externally calculated rates which give both you and your customers more precise shipping costs. With Shopify Advanced, you have access to a complete suite of tools to manage your high-volume business efficiently and effectively.

As with any platform, Shopify contains both advantages and drawbacks to keep in mind when making a decision about it. Below are a few key advantages and drawbacks:

Positive Aspects:

User-Friendly Interface: Shopify is well known for its intuitive interface and straightforward design, making it an excellent option for newcomers to e-commerce or those seeking a hassle-free experience. From adding products to managing orders, Shopify makes everything simple even without technical knowledge.

Comprehensive Features: Shopify provides an extensive suite of tools to efficiently run your online business, from stock and SEO management tools, sales analytics and CRM platforms, CRM tools, and customer relationship management software – meaning it has almost all of the resources you need to manage an successful online store.

Omnichannel Selling: Shopify allows you to sell through various channels – not only your online store, but also social media platforms, online marketplaces, and physical shops or pop-up shops – in order to connect with more of your potential customers and maximize sales potential. This flexibility means reaching them at their preferred platforms!

Responsive Customer Support: The platform provides continuous customer support via email, live chat, and phone if any issues arise. In addition, there’s an extensive Help Center as well as active community forums that offer additional assistance.

Scalability: Shopify has the flexibility to grow with your business as your needs do. As your requirements evolve, upgrading to more sophisticated plans with greater features and capabilities keeps costs manageable at each stage. This means Shopify stays cost-effective through every stage of your business growth.

Drawbacks:

Transaction Fees: To the disadvantage of smaller businesses, Shopify charges additional transaction fees per sale on all sales not made through its payment gateway – Shopify Payments. This may diminish profits significantly and deteriorate profit margins substantially.

Limited customization: While Shopify provides numerous customization options, certain restrictions such as HTML and CSS coding languages constrain what can be achieved when it comes to tweaking store design and functionality. Some users require additional flexibility for tailoring their store.

Costs: Though Shopify’s pricing plans are reasonably competitive, costs can quickly mount if you factor in premium themes, paid apps, and transaction fees (if you don’t utilize Shopify Payments).

Head-to-Head: Shopify vs. Ecwid

Both the Shopify platform and the Ecwid platform offer e-commerce solutions, but each is designed to address different needs. The Shopify platform is an comprehensive e-commerce platform designed for running entire online stores; offering inclusive tools for managing products, sales, customers, and sales channels ranging from your own website through social media to marketplaces like eBay or Amazon. The Ecwid platform, on the other hand, is a flexible e-commerce solution that emphasizes integrating existing websites or social media platforms, facilitating smooth online selling without the need to create a full-fledged online store.

Analyzing the Differences: Shopify Vs WooCommerce

WooCommerce is a cost-free e-commerce plugin designed specifically for the WordPress websites, unlike the Shopify platform which acts as a independent platform. While offering features such as managing products, shopping cart functionality, and payment options; its administration depends on you in terms of website hosting security and optimization. WooCommerce provides flexibility and control, enabling you to customize and adapt your e-commerce store based on your specific hosting requirements and preferences.

Head-to-Head: Shopify vs. BigCommerce

Both the Shopify platform and the BigCommerce platform provide all-inclusive e-commerce platforms, offering numerous features for operating an e-commerce store. Both platforms share similar functionalities when it comes to product management, sales, SEO, and multichannel selling tools. The Shopify platform and BigCommerce provide powerful tools that allow effective inventory management, sales processing, SEO, and selling on multiple channels.

Shopify vs Magento

Magento is an open-source e-commerce platform known for its flexibility and customization options, but also for being complicated to set up. While the Shopify platform provides user-friendly support that’s suitable for newcomers to e-commerce, Magento requires significant technical knowledge (or the budget for professional developer assistance) in order to be effective. Magento offers extensive personalization options, enabling users to tailor their online stores to their specific business needs. However, establishing and handling a Magento store may demand advanced technical knowledge and proficiency in order to maximize its complete potential. Shopify, on the other hand, provides a intuitive dashboard that simplifies the task of creating and running an e-commerce store, eliminating the necessity for advanced technical knowledge.
